Storage conditions and terms of lyophilized poly- and monoclonal antitoxic peroxidase conjugates

Abstract: The article discusses the selection of optimal conditions for the lyophilization of poly- and monoclonal peroxidase conjugates used in the direct version of the enzyme immunoassay intended for the cholera toxin detection in Vibrio cholerae O1, O139 strains. Effective stabilizers included in protective media comprise 1 % sucrose, 1 % sodium thiosulfate, 0.5 % egg albumin, or 0.5 % bovine serum albumin.
